Job description

Salon city's basic education Ollikkalan school currently has a permanent teaching assistant position available, 25 hours per week. Ollikkalan school serves about 220 students and around 30 education professionals work together for the benefit of the pupils.

In our school we study with diverse teaching methods, learner-centered approach, activity-based learning, cross-class collaboration, internationality and pupil participation are central.

Your role will include supporting pupils’ upbringing as a key part of their education and guiding learning in the sixth grade special class. You will also participate in planning the guidance for student wellbeing with your partner and implement class activities together with other teaching staff.

The position requires qualification as a school assistant or equivalent in care, youth or education sector.

Adaptability to different situations and good collaboration and group-management skills are required. Preference will be given to experience working with children of different ages and pupils requiring different kinds of support, as well as language-sensitive guidance.

We value flexibility, initiative and positive pedagogy as well as solution-oriented work approach.

The position pays at step level 2379.57 euros per month (100% of full-time). In addition, depending on tenure there may be additional pay according to the collective agreement. We also pay a personal allowance to all employees whose service has lasted over 6 months. Work and salary payments pause during school breaks to the extent that the employee does not have annual leave.

The successful candidate will present a criminal record extract in accordance with the Act 504/2002 on the investigation of the criminal background of persons working with children. A six-month probation period applies if the terms of the collective agreement are met.
